The student's conclusion was incorrect because the tropical rainforest biome has an average of 200-400 centimeters or 80-100 inches of rain a year. The correct biome based on the climatograph is temperate grassland because, on average per year, this biome has 25-75 centimeters of precipitation each year. Its temperature is ranging from 0-25 degrees Celcius.
